France Fines Russia-Linked Oil Tanker in Shadow Fleet Crackdown

The French government has imposed a multimillion-euro fine on a Russian-linked oil tanker, the Grinch, for violating European sanctions on Russian oil. The vessel was seized by the French navy last month in the Mediterranean Sea.

The Grinch, which originated from Murmansk in the Russian Arctic, was boarded by the French navy as part of a global effort to crack down on shadow fleet ships used to export sanctioned crude. Moscow’s war in Ukraine has led to a significant increase in the size of this dark fleet, comprising vessels without standard insurance, often flying under questionable flags, or no flags at all, and with opaque ownership structures.

Shadow Fleet Growth and Sanctions

More than 600 tankers have been sanctioned by a combination of the European Union, the U.K., and the U.S. for their links to Russia. Of these, more than 570 have been blacklisted by the EU since June 2024, surpassing any other authority.

The Grinch‘s seizure was not an isolated incident. In September, the oil tanker Boracay was boarded off France’s Atlantic coast for failing to provide proof of its nationality and flag, as well as refusing to comply with requests from the navy.

French Authorities’ Crackdown

French Foreign Minister Jean-Noel Barrot emphasized the consequences of circumventing European sanctions, stating that Russia will no longer be able to finance its war with impunity via a shadow fleet off France’s coasts. The Grinch will leave French waters after “paying several millions of euros and three weeks of costly immobilization at Fos-sur-Mer,” according to Barrot.

The exact amount of the fine was not specified, but it is clear that the French government is committed to enforcing sanctions on Russia-linked vessels.
